Firmware 3.5.2-RC1 for Original Prusa i3 MK2.5  

Jakub Dolezal
UPDATE: Final version is out

Hi guys,
this is an upgrade of the firmware for the Original Prusa i3 MK2.5. Keep in mind this a release candidate (testing version) for experienced users 😎

What is new?
-> More quiet print fan operation
-> Heatbed regulation improved
-> Improved heater temperature regulation
-> Spool join for multi-material prints
-> Smarter load/unload function
-> Mintemp for MK2.5 updated
-> SD card menu is shown automatically when the card is inserted
-> Safer communication between MMU2 and printer
-> Crash detection for zero target temperature fixed

More quiet print fan operation:
This change is significant especially for low fan speeds.

Heatbed regulation improved:
Heatbed PWM now works on a higher frequency. This helps to reduce the power supplies "clicking" noises.

Improved heater temperature regulation:
When changing temperatures during the print, temperature regulation was very slow in some cases led to preheat error. Regulation has been improved. This should solve issue #1362.

SpoolJoin for multi-material prints:
It is now possible to use the "SpoolJoin" function also with multi-material prints. If some filament is depleted, the printer replaces it with next filament for the rest of print (for example if filament 2 was depleted, the printer starts using filament 3 instead). If there is no filament which can be used (all filaments were depleted), the printer waits for the user to insert new filament manually.

Smarter load/unload function:
If a user chooses load (or unload) in the menu with a cold nozzle, nozzle preheat menu automatically appears. After selecting material, preheat starts. When the nozzle is hot and the printer is ready for a load, beeper signal occurs. This function is working on single material printers with load/autoload and unload. It is not currently implemented for multi-material printers (load to nozzle, unload and eject).

Mintemp for MK2.5 updated:
"Mintemp" is now checked after a short period of preheating. This is necessary for maximum reliability on all MK2.5 Rambo boards.

Supported printers:
Original Prusa i3 MK3
Original Prusa i3 MK3 MMU2
Original Prusa i3 MK2.5
Original Prusa i3 MK2.5 MMU2

Download link:

Firmware flashing guide:

Please report any bug here:

As always, we wish you happy printing and look forward to your feedback!

Posted : 08/02/2019 11:49 am
New Member
I upgraded to FIRMWARE 3.5.2 - from Feb 12 (there seems to be no thread for that version specificalyl yet).

Anyhow, I am now getting
"Some problem encountered Z leveling enforced" while starting a job. This happens with one of the three back row points (Z:3 / Z2 / Z:1). I then do the Z leveling, it starts over again and sometimes it succeeds in second go, but like just now I had this 3 times in a row with different back row points.

My cal data shows
Y distance L:7.71mm / R:7.73mm
skew 0.06
x: -1.83
y: -0.79
if that helps perhaps.

Have some thresholds changed or what should I be looking for to solve this. I have done the whole XYZ calibaration reset / recalibrate a few times and that process succeeds with no errors.

Posted : 17/02/2019 10:43 am